IR Remote control
The volume potentiometer can be remotely controlled using any infrared (IR) remote control.
The special feature is that the Phonitor learns your remote and not the other way around. You do not need a learn-
able remote control. Take, for example, the remote control of the CD player. Out of the many buttons there are two
you hardly use if at all. Assign Volume up / Volume down to these two buttons and let the Phonitor learn them.
While learning the IR remote control commands set the Output switch () to Mute.
VUmeters light up red.
Press the IR REMOTE LEARN button () on the rear of the unit. The Power LED now lights up
brighter.
Point your remote control towards the VU meters () and push the button you wish to use
to lower the volume. The power LED lights up once per push. Press the same button repeatedly until the
power LED lights up three times within a short interval – programming this button is then completed.
Point your remote control towards the VU meters () and push the button you wish to use to increase the
volume. The power LED lights up once per push. Press the same button repeatedly until the power LED
lights up three times within a short interval – programming this button is then completed.
(Learn mode ends automatically after the second button is learned.)
